The MS Word document comprises Grade 10 Business Studies Lesson Plans Term 1 2026. The PDF version is also available upon your request.

The lesson plans are structurally organized to cover 13 weeks, with a comprehensive schedule of 6 lessons per week, ensuring adequate time for deep engagement with the content. The entire plan is strictly aligned with the KICD-approved CBE curriculum, focusing on learner-centered activities and core competencies.
